js中Number對象方法


toString()   可把一個 Number 對象轉換為一個字符串,並返回結果

  NumberObject toString(radix)

  radix :可選。規定表示數字的基數,使 2 ~ 36 之間的整數。若省略該參數,則使用基數 10。但是要注意,如果該參數是 10 以外的其他值,則 ECMAScript 標准允許實現返回任意值

  返回值:數字的字符串表示。例如,當 radix 為 2 時,NumberObject 會被轉換為二進制值表示的字符串

 

  toLocaleString()   可把一個 Number 對象轉換為本地格式的字符串

  返回值:數字的字符串表示,由實現決定,根據本地規范進行格式化,可能影響到小數點或千分位分隔符采用的標點符號

 

  toFixed()   可把 Number 四舍五入為指定小數位數的數字

  NumberObject . toFixed(num)

  num必需。規定小數的位數,是 0 ~ 20 之間的值,包括 0 和 20,有些實現可以支持更大的數值范圍。如果省略了該參數,將用 0 代替

  返回 NumberObject 的字符串表示,不采用指數計數法,小數點后有固定的 num 位數字。如果必要,該數字會被舍入,也可以用 0 補足,以便它達到指定的長度。如果 num 大於 le+21,則該方法只調用 NumberObject.toString(),返回采用指數計數法表示的字符串

 

  toExponential()   可把對象的值轉換成指數計數法。

  NumberObject . toExponential(num)

  num必需。規定小數的位數,是 0 ~ 20 之間的值,包括 0 和 20,有些實現可以支持更大的數值范圍。如果省略了該參數,將用 0 代替

  返回 NumberObject 的字符串表示,采用指數計數法,即小數點之前有一位數字,小數點之后有 num 位數字。該數字的小數部分將被舍入,必要時用 0 補足,以便它達到指定的長度

 

  valueOf()   可以字符串返回數字

  字符串的輸出通常等於該數字,valueOf() 方法通常由 JavaScript 在后台自動進行調用,而不是顯式地處於代碼中

  NumberObject valueOf()

 


免責聲明!

本站轉載的文章為個人學習借鑒使用,本站對版權不負任何法律責任。如果侵犯了您的隱私權益,請聯系本站郵箱yoyou2525@163.com刪除。



 
粵ICP備18138465號   © 2018-2025 CODEPRJ.COM